📄 About

Custom Diffusion: Multi-Concept Customization of Text-to-Image Diffusion (CVPR 2023)

custom-diffusion has 2k stars on GitHub. It has been forked 142 times. custom-diffusion is written mainly in Python. It has been in active development since 2022. Its main topics are computer-vision, customization, diffusion-models, few-shot.
